Luxury Nail Salon Hit by Overnight Ram-Raid for the Third Time in a Matter of Months

In a troubling series of incidents, LaLa Nail Co, a luxury nail salon in Essendon, Melbourne’s north-west, was ram-raided by a black ute around 3.30am. This attack marks the third time the salon has faced aggression since its opening earlier this year. Police found the vehicle crashed inside the store, with a threatening message spray-painted on the side that read, “pay ur tick you fat dog.”

Local residents have expressed concerns about the salon being a target, particularly highlighting the owner, a young woman, who has faced significant hardship. The business, which has only been operating for three months, has suffered repetitive vandalism and damage. Following the latest incident, the owner voiced her distress over the emotional toll and safety risks posed by the repeated attacks, stating it has caused her to reconsider the future of her business.

In an Instagram post, LaLa Nail Co addressed the ongoing situation, lamenting the impact on their reputation and the well-being of nearby residents. The owner indicated that the persistent damage was overwhelming and deeply affected her mental health, saying, “We are now faced with the difficult question of whether we can continue.”

In a heartfelt reflection shared on social media, the owner, who goes by ‘Sam’, expressed her sense of despair, questioning how much more she could withstand after investing so much to open the salon. “These people are just pure evil,” she remarked, emphasising her feelings of being beaten down.

Police are treating the ram-raid as a targeted act, with investigations still in progress. Earlier in June, the business was similarly attacked when offenders smashed the front windows using a hammer. Reports suggest that the intended target of these attacks may have connections to the salon but not the owners themselves.

As the community rallies around LaLa Nail Co, the future of the business hangs in the balance amidst growing fears of safety and repeated harassment.
